Retail lighting refers to all the lighting a business uses to highlight particular items or regions of their store or to make their space more noticeable. A key component of one's merchandising strategy when starting a retail business is the lighting they select.
Effective lighting creates ambiance, directs customers to crucial parts of a store, and can even entice customers inside and keep them there for a longer period of time.
Comparable in efficiency to conventional PAR and fluorescent lighting, retail LED lighting is a viable option. In addition to being available in a wide range of Kelvin temperatures and having some of the highest color rendering indices, LED lights have an average lifespan of fifty thousand hours (CRI).
Retail establishments can regulate the angle at which light is emitted as well as the color, brightness level, timing, and other factors with the use of a common type of retail LED lighting known as LED directional lighting.
There are LED retrofits available that allow one to change present incandescent or fluorescent bulbs, which are energy-hungry, for retail establishments that want to stick with their current retail lighting fixtures.

New SMD Downlight for indoor retail locations is unveiled by Syska LED.
According to Syska, the unique Syska LED Recessed SMD Downlight is the ideal lighting option for indoor applications because it can be utilized in offices, showrooms, houses, malls, and other commercial and residential buildings. Aluminum and thermoplastic are the primary materials that make up the light's main component, which helps to make it lightweight and effectively dissipate heat.

The Syska light is not only the brightest source of illumination, but it is also incredibly simple to install in any indoor space. There are five different power levels for the Syska LED Recessed SMD Downlight: 3W, 6W, 9W, 12W, and 15W. The input voltage range is between AC90 and 300V at 50Hz, and the corresponding lumen outputs are 210, 420, 630, 840, and 1050 lm.
